Event Details

 

The second annual Staten Island Not-for-Profit Conference hosted by the Staten Island NFP Association and the Council on the Arts and Humanities for Staten Island will take place on

Friday, March 16th, 2012 at Wagner College's Spiro Center.    

This year's event will once again feature two keynote / panel presentations, six breakout sessions, one-on-one mentoring, and the best chance that the Borough's not-for-profits leaders have each year to spend time with their colleagues from around the sector.

Our morning keynote speakers will be Tim Delaney, President of the National Council on Nonprofits, Doug Sauer of the New York Council on Nonprofits, and Caroline Woolard from Ourgoods.org, who will also lead a breakout session regarding innovative ways in which not-for-profits can share resources.  We will also be joined in the afternoon by the Director of the Fund for the City of New York.

The breakout sessions offered at the Conference will include:

  • Legal issues for not-for-profits, led by the general counsel of one of the City's largest not-for-profit cultural institutions;
  • Update on the Lois and Richard Nicotra Foundation with Kristine Garlisi;
  • The tactical skills of fundraising - how to reach and interact with funders, led by the Whelan Group;
  • Advanced social media for not-for-profits - how your organization can create an app of its own;
  • Effective and unique methods of sharing resources with others in the not-for-profit sector;
  • Review of the new Governor's and Attorney General's regulations regarding not-for-profits in New York State.

Continental breakfast and lunch are included in the ticket price.  Pre-registration is required - no tickets will be sold the day of the event.
